Removing the rails

The rails can be removed for cleaning.

Detaching the rails

1

Lift up the front of the rail and unhook it (figure A).

2

Then pull the whole rail forward and remove it 
(Fig. B).

Clean the rails with cleaning agent and a sponge. For 
stubborn deposits of dirt, use a brush.

Refitting the rails

1

First insert the rail into the rear socket and press it 
to the back slightly (figure A).

2

Then hook it into the front socket (figure B).

The rails fit both the left and right sides. Ensure that, as 
shown in figure B, the recess is below.

Catalytic cleaning (cleaning aid)

You can order an oven ceiling and an oven back wall, 

which are coated with a special catalytic enamelling, for 
the cooking compartment as a spare part. Dirt is 
removed at high temperatures during the catalytic 
cleaning.

This process does not clean the non-catalytic 
components, such as the cooking compartment floor, 
side walls, inside of the door and glass panel.

You can delay the catalytic cleaning switch-off time (for 
example, if you want the catalytic cleaning to run during 
the night).

m

Warning – Risk of burns! 

The appliance will become very hot on the outside 
during the cleaning function. Never touch the appliance 
door. Allow the appliance to cool down. Keep children 
at a safe distance.

Preparing catalytic cleaning

Remove coarse soiling and food remainders from 
the oven.

Clean the oven interior base and side walls 
manually, the door seals, the inside of the door and 
the glass panel because the catalytic cleaning 
process does not clean these parts.

Remove all loose interior parts from the oven 
interior. There must be no objects left in the 
interior.

Close the oven door.
